从豆包手机谈起:端侧智能的愿景与路线图
AI前线· 2025-12-22 05:01
Core Viewpoint - The launch of Doubao Mobile Assistant by ByteDance signifies a significant shift in the application paradigm of large models, transitioning from "Chat" to "Action," establishing it as the first system-level GUI Agent in the industry [2][3]. Technical Analysis and Evaluation - The core technology of Doubao Mobile Assistant is the GUI Agent, which has evolved from an "external framework" to a "model-native intelligent agent" between 2023 and 2025. The early stage (2023-2024) relied on external frameworks that limited the agent's capabilities due to dependency on prompt engineering and external tools [4]. - The introduction of visual language models driven by imitation learning in 2024 marked a shift to model-native capabilities, allowing the agent to understand interfaces directly from pixel inputs, significantly enhancing adaptability to unstructured GUIs [5]. - By 2024-2025, reinforcement learning-driven visual language models became mainstream, enabling agents to autonomously execute tasks in dynamic environments. Doubao Mobile Assistant embodies this technological evolution [5][7]. Development History of GUI Agent - Previous GUI Agents were often limited to demo stages due to reliance on Android accessibility services, which had significant drawbacks. Doubao Mobile Assistant overcomes these issues through a customized OS that allows for non-intrusive system-level control [7][8]. - The model architecture of Doubao Mobile Assistant employs a collaborative end-cloud model, indicating a shift from experimental to practical applications of GUI Agents [8]. Limitations and Future Outlook - Doubao Mobile Assistant faces three major challenges: security risks associated with cloud-side model reliance, insufficient autonomous task completion capabilities, and limited ecological coverage [9][10][11]. - The assistant currently operates as a passive tool, lacking personalized proactive service capabilities. Future developments must focus on enhancing privacy, environmental perception, complex decision-making, and personalized service [12][13]. Evolution of End-Side Intelligence - The emergence of system-level GUI Agents presents a fundamental contradiction between the need for comprehensive operational visibility and user privacy concerns. A balance must be struck to ensure user data sovereignty while providing intelligent services [13][14]. - The future AI mobile ecosystem should adhere to the principle of "end-side native, cloud collaboration," ensuring that sensitive user data remains on-device while leveraging cloud capabilities for complex tasks [14][15]. Autonomous Intelligence and User Interaction - Doubao Mobile Assistant's current capabilities are based on extensive data training, but future autonomous intelligence must enable agents to learn and adapt in dynamic environments, overcoming challenges in generalization, autonomy, and long-term interaction [22][24][25]. - The transition from passive execution to proactive service is essential for personal assistants to reduce user cognitive load and enhance user experience [29][30][31]. Industry Trends and Future Predictions - In the short term (within one year), more mobile assistants are expected to launch, intensifying competition between application developers and hardware manufacturers [35]. - In the medium term (2-3 years), the concept of a "personal exclusive assistant" will solidify, with end-side models evolving to provide personalized experiences based on user data [36]. - In the long term (3-5 years), a new type of end-side hardware will emerge, integrating high privacy operations and lightweight tasks, ensuring data sovereignty and rapid response times [38].

ChatGPT Pulse上线,OpenAI官方解读如何推动LLM迈向主动智能
锦秋集· 2025-09-26 11:31
Core Insights - OpenAI's ChatGPT Pulse represents a significant advancement in AI technology, transitioning from a passive tool to an active daily assistant that personalizes user interactions by analyzing data such as chat history and calendars [1][2] - The next paradigm shift in AI is envisioned as creating an "automated researcher" capable of independently advancing scientific research over long time horizons, marking a move from reactive to proactive intelligence [2][4] Group 1: Automated Researcher Development - OpenAI's primary research goal for the next 1 to 5 years is to develop an "automated researcher" that can autonomously discover new knowledge and ideas, with a focus on automating machine learning research and other scientific fields [6][7] - The effectiveness of this automated researcher will be measured by its ability to perform reasoning over extended time spans, currently estimated at 1 to 5 hours for high school-level tasks [6][8] Group 2: New Evaluation Directions - Traditional evaluation benchmarks are becoming saturated, prompting OpenAI to shift focus from generic performance metrics to assessing the model's ability to make original scientific discoveries in economically valuable problems [8][9] - High-stakes competitions in mathematics and programming are seen as strong indicators of a model's potential for future research success, despite the saturation of these competitions [9][10] Group 3: Reasoning and Stability - The evolution of AI models towards "agents" capable of multi-step planning introduces a challenge in balancing long-term planning and memory retention, which are crucial for executing complex tasks [10][11] - OpenAI posits that the relationship between depth and stability is not a trade-off but rather a unified challenge, where enhancing reasoning capabilities can improve both long-term agency and execution quality [12][13] Group 4: Verifiability and Openness - The distinction between verifiable and open-ended problems is fluid, with the complexity and time scale of a problem influencing its nature as either verifiable or exploratory [15][16] - As the time frame for solving a problem extends, even clearly defined tasks can evolve into open-ended explorations requiring strategic and creative approaches [16][19] Group 5: Talent Development and Organizational Culture - OpenAI emphasizes the importance of resilience, experience, and a balance between long-term belief and truthfulness in its researchers, fostering an environment conducive to long-term exploration without short-term pressures [20][21] - The organization seeks diverse talent from various fields, prioritizing problem-solving skills and a willingness to tackle difficult challenges over social media prominence [21]
